What Counts As Emergency Plumbing


While a plumbing emergency isn't precisely one-size-fits-all, there can be many telltale signs of a plumbing emergency. Basically a plumbing emergency is any kind of plumbing-related issue that can cause damages to a residential or commercial property or its inhabitants.
A few determining signs of a plumbing emergency that we will certainly review are as adheres to; low or no water stress, water not heating up appropriately, an overflowing toilet. If your emergency does not fit any one of these descriptions however you still believe could be hazardous for you or your residential property never ever hesitate to call an emergency plumber or your home administration if relevant.

Low Or No Water Pressure


A case of low water stress, or no water stress, need to be extremely easy to identify while the resource of the concern might be a lot more elusive. If water is just barely coming out of your tap, or otherwise whatsoever, then you too have been impacted by this common concern, however what can you do concerning it?
Start by recognizing all of the areas that your water stress is dampened, you can do this by going via your residence as well as transforming on all the taps to see how solid the stress is in each room of the house. If only one faucet has low stress first attempt cleaning the screen before looking for a specialist.

Water Not Heating Properly


If your water is running however you can't get it warm enough to have a bathroom or even pleasantly wash your hands there may be a problem with your plumbing's furnace. This is generally a trouble that can be settled in an issue of mins. First, inspect the breaker switch for the water heater in your fuse panel to guarantee it hasn't been tripped, if it has simply snap it right into the off position and back on once again. If the breaker hasn't been tripped, the issue could be with the burner for your hot water heater, in this instance, it's finest to call an expert to test, and possibly change the bad element.

Overruning Toilet


This typical inconvenience is typically a result of one of 3 points; a clogged drain, malfunctioning float, or blocked vent pipeline. The initial of which is one of the most usual, this issue can usually be fixed with a plunger, however often can need a "snake" in which situation it's most likely best to call a plumber. Next, repairing a malfunctioning float can in some cases be as easy as wiggling the flush handle or getting rid of the cover on the back of the bathroom to examine the concern additionally. Last but not least, an obstructed air vent pipe can be tricky organization that might need reducing or including to pipes so best to call a plumber for this issue too.

What Should I Do If I Have a Plumbing Emergency?


Call An Emergency Plumber


Even if you have an idea of where the problem developed, it is crucial to call your local emergency plumber to guide you through what you should do next. When you call a plumber, they can provide you with information and instructions to help make sure no more damage happens to your home.



You should make sure you call dependable, highly trained professionals who are there to help you. An emergency can happen at any time of the day or night. That’s why Whipple Service Champions offers after-hours plumbing in SLC and the surrounding areas for your convenience.


Shut Off Your Water


This is an essential step because you don’t want water damage in your home. If there is a leak in your pipes, you want to turn off your water supply by shutting the valves off. It’s a good idea to turn off the main water supply near your water meter.



You can also turn off the water heater if this is the source of the problem and you know how to operate the appliance. This can be a more significant plumbing issue, so it is important to get an emergency plumber to your home if you don’t know how to work your water heater.


Try to Remove Clogs


Is a stubborn clog causing water to back up through your drains? After turning off your water valve, there still can be leftover resting water in your pipes. Drain the water out by opening an outdoor spigot or turning on your hose to avoid contributing to the problem any further.



If there is a massive clog hiding in your drains, don’t use regular store-bought chemical products. Use a plunger or handheld snake to break up as much of the clog as possible, or wait for an emergency plumber to arrive.


Clean Up Small Leaks


During a plumbing emergency, it is essential that you try to keep the damage to a minimum, meaning that you should do everything you can to clean any leaks you can. While emergency services are on their way, try applying plumbers tape to any leaks you can see. Cleaning up any water leaks is important because it is less work for your plumber and stops any water damage from ruining your floors, walls, and furniture.
